A ball mill is a crucial piece of equipment in gold ore mineral processing, used for grinding crushed ore into fine particles to liberate gold for further extraction. Here’s a detailed breakdown of its role, working principles, and key considerations:

1. Role of Ball Mill in Gold Ore Processing
– Grinding: Reduces gold-bearing ore to a fine powder (typically <100 µm) to expose gold particles for cyanidation, flotation, or gravity separation.
– Liberation: Breaks down ore to free gold from surrounding gangue minerals.
– Consistency: Ensures uniform particle size for efficient downstream processing.

2. Working Principle
– A rotating cylindrical shell filled with grinding media (steel balls) tumbles the ore.
– Impact and attrition forces break down the ore into smaller particles.
– Discharge can be grate or overflow type, depending on the processing requirements.

– Shell: Rotating drum lined with wear-resistant material (e.g., rubber or manganese steel).
– Grinding Media: Steel balls (varying sizes for optimal grinding efficiency).
– Drive System: Motor, gearbox, and bearings.
– Feed/Discharge: Hoppers for input and output of material.

4. Critical Parameters for Optimization
| Parameter | Importance |
|——————–|—————————————————————————|
| Mill Speed | Must reach 65–75% of critical speed for effective cascading/impact. |
| Ball Charge | Typically 30–45% of mill volume; affects grinding efficiency. |
| Ore Feed Size | Smaller feed size improves throughput and reduces energy consumption. |
| Pulp Density | Optimal slurry density (~70–80% solids) ensures efficient grinding. |
| Retention Time | Longer residence time increases fineness but may overgrind gold particles. |

– Gold Particle Size: Overgrinding can lead to gold losses in slimes; controlled milling is essential.
– Chemical Additives: Lime or cyanide may be added to the mill to start leaching early.
– Gravity Recovery: Some mills integrate centrifugal concentrators (e.g., Knelson) to recover coarse gold before finer grinding.
